Tips for saving energy
The following information will help you to use
your appliance in an ecological way, and to
save energy:
x Use dark coloured or enamel coated
cookware in the oven since the heat
transmission will be better.
x While cooking your dishes, perform a
preheating operation if it is advised in the
user manual or cooking instructions.
x Do not open the door of the oven
frequently during cooking.
x Try to cook more than one dish in the oven
at the same time whenever possible. You
can cook by placing two cooking vessels
onto the wire shelf.
x Cook more than one dish one after
another. The oven will already be hot.
x You can save energy by switching off your
oven a few minutes before the end of the
cooking time. Do not open the oven door.
x Defrost frozen dishes before cooking
them.
DANGER: Risk of electric shock!
Before starting any work on the
electrical installation, please
disconnect the appliance from the
mains supply.
DANGER: The appliance must be
connected to the mains supply
only by authorised and qualified
persons. The appliances warranty
period starts only after correct
installation. The manufacturer
shall not be held responsible for
damages arising from procedures
carried out by unauthorised
persons.
DANGER: Risk of electric shock,
short circuit or fire by damage of
the mains lead! The mains lead
must not be clamped, bent or
trapped or come into contact with
hot parts of the oven. If the mains
lead is damaged, it must be
replaced by a qualified electrician.
Connecting the sprague to the oven
WARNING! ELECTRICAL
CONNECTION MUST ONLY BE
DONE BY A QUALIFIED
ELECTRICIAN!
Purchase a standard plastic/metal saddle
type bracket, capable of going around the 20
mm diameter sprague and with a hole pitch
of 38 mm (Plastic) 45 mm (Metal), from your
local hardware and 2 off 4.2 mm x 12 mm
self tapping screws.
Connect the cabling onto the stove
connecter.
Place the plastic/metal saddle around the
sprague and fasten via the 2 self tapping
screws onto the factory pre punched holes
on the back of the stove.
